tjh290633 wrote:I recall looking for a replacement for ICI in the Chemicals sector when they were taken over and, finding none, looked lower down the valuations, to find Yule Catto (now Synthomer) yielding over 6%. This was early in 2008 and I bought at 153p, then again later in the year at 82p. Then they decided to stop paying dividends (it being that time) and the price fell to about 40p before rebounding. I sold my usual 25% when they went overweight in October 2009 at 147p, and then in September 2010 I got rid of the rest at 240p. That gave me an IRR of almost 30%, so not unsatisfactory. The dividend had been reinstated, but the yield was about 1.8%, so it was time to bid farewell.
